Energy Efficient Resource Allocation in Wireless Energy Harvesting Sensor Networks
Author Name : Lakshmi R, Arul Priya S, Deepa C, Gowsika B, Jeevitha B
ABSTRACT
The energy harvesting cognitive wireless sensor network (EHCWSN) introduces energy harvesting technology and cognitive radio technology into the traditional wireless sensor network (WSN), which significantly prolongs the working life of the sensor node and effectively alleviates the congestion problem of the unlicensed spectrum. Due to the uncertainty of the energy harvesting process and the behavior of the primary user (PU), how to allocate and manage limited network resources is a crucial problem in the EHCWSN. In this work, a new Q-learning based channel selection method is proposed for the energy harvesting process and the randomness of the PU’s behavior in the sensor network. By continuously interacting and learning with the environment, the method guides the secondary user (SU) to select the channel with better channel quality. This proposed design is done by Network simulator 2 by using Tcl script.
